Tang Ling's expression turned cold.

If Andrew's words attracted hatred from others, Tang Ling would not care because he never had a sense of belonging to Safety Sector No. 17 to begin with.

Therefore, it did not matter whether the others liked or hated him.

However, the key point was that Andrew seemed to be hinting that Tang Ling was hiding something. It was the exact opposite of Tang Ling's intention to keep a low profile.

From a certain aspect, Andrew had placed Tang Ling in a dangerous position because he never forgot that there was an invisible hand behind his back, targeting him.

However, should he just let Andrew do whatever he wanted?

Never!

From that night onwards, resistance had been carved into Tang Ling's bones. He would never let others control his fate, let alone through despicable means like words.

Tang Ling smiled and looked at Andrew innocently. "Why do you pay so much attention to me, the last place on the leaderboard?

"So much so that they even found out about my appetite, which was only revealed after the closed-door training?"

Indeed, Tang Ling's retort was only two sentences, but it was enough to make one's imagination run wild and dispel their doubts.

Why did Andrew know about the last place on the leaderboard? Tang Ling had purposely exposed his appetite during the first test after the closed-door training and he even found a perfect excuse for it.

Since it was on the table, it was no longer worth digging into.

Andrew's smile froze. His gaze at Tang Ling had a deeper meaning that only he understood, but he did not lose his composure. He said calmly, "To me, everyone in the First Reserved Camp is worth paying attention to.

But that's not the point. The point is, I'm the one who asked for Vian's mission. So, Vian, please hand the mission back to me. "Tang Ling did not think his rebuttal would be enough to make Andrew suffer.

Now, he had to solve another key problem.

Vian looked at Tang Ling. According to the rules, as the person in charge of the mission, she could delegate the mission to someone else at any time.

Just like the Summit Squad.

"Very well, the mission is now officially delegated to Tang Ling." Looking at Tang Ling's determined and warm eyes, Vian somehow felt at ease, so she naturally delegated the mission to Tang Ling.

Tang Ling smiled and patted Vian's shoulder to comfort her.

Then, he put his hands in his pockets and looked at Andrew leisurely, then at all his friends.

"I hate being forced, so I will never give up on this mission."

"But I'm also very afraid of the accident that Senior mentioned, so I won't force others to do the mission."

"Logically speaking, a group mission can be accepted by two or more people. Yu, you must join the mission, right? "Tang Ling asked with a smile.

Yu nodded.

He had the Yufeng Clan behind him, so naturally, he was not afraid of the Summit Squad. Moreover, Hank was Yu's opponent, so there was no reason for him to back down in their first face-to-face battle.

"The rest of you, I think you can withdraw from this mission. After all, it's just my insistence, "Tang Ling said seriously.

He acted as if he was fighting, but he didn't want to implicate others. In fact, his goal was not to implicate anyone.

After all, this mission was part of his plan. He had to accept it, so there was no need for him to drag everyone down with him.

As for Yu and Orston, there was no need to worry. After all, the two of them were very confident.

"I want to join." Orston pouted. He did not understand what was going on between Tang Ling and Andrew's words.

However, he understood that a powerhouse would never back down in the face of a threat. Moreover, comrades on the battlefield should never be abandoned.

"I-I want to join too," Andy said softly. Andy said softly. He did not even have the courage to look at Hank, but somehow, following Tang Ling's footsteps became an obsession in his heart. Even though Tang Ling was unreliable at times, it was hard for him to reject him.

"I'll join." Vian clenched her fists. There was no other reason. She just did not want to miss out on a mission with Tang Ling.

"Vian?" Christina was a little surprised by Vian's courage, but she understood it right away since Vian had always liked Tang Ling.

Considering their friendship, Christina hesitated for a second before she said, "I'll go with Vian. We'll never be separated during a mission."

In the end, Amir was the only one who did not say anything. He lowered his head and no one knew what was going through his mind.

"Amir, you …" Tang Ling understood how nervous Amir was. He had climbed up from the bottom of the settlement, so he had a lot of concerns.

Tang Ling instinctively wanted to persuade Amir that it would be fine even if he did not join.

To his surprise, right after Tang Ling spoke, Amir looked up and said, "I'll join." He then lowered his head again.

With that, no one in the Fierce Dragon Squad backed out of the group mission.

"What a deep friendship. It's enviable." Andrew smiled and said with a regretful expression, "I also admire your courage."

"Ptooey!" Tang Ling spat at Andrew with disdain and disgust.

The rude action caused an uproar. Every member of the Summit Squad was enraged. Even Andrew, who had been maintaining his noble demeanor, had a cold expression on his face.

"Don't be so pretentious, okay?"

"Who here doesn't know that the Summit Squad wants to monopolize this group mission?"

"I don't know why all of you are so eager. It might not just be because of the mission reward, but so what? Everyone here has witnessed your seniors, and one of the top rankers, threaten us juniors who are at the bottom.

"So, everyone, please remember this. If anything happens to any of us in the Fierce Dragon Squad, remember what the Summit Squad has done for us tonight. We must get to the bottom of this! What's there to be afraid of dying on the battlefield?

"What we should be afraid of is fighting with our lives on the line, only to be stabbed in the back by our comrades."

Tang Ling emphasized each and every word seriously.

"You sure are bold." Dier could no longer hold it in and threw a punch at Tang Ling.

Tang Ling did not dodge the punch and took it head-on. He was pushed back seven to eight meters and fell beside the fire.

Dier's anger was not extinguished yet. He strode forward, but Yu and Orston stood in front of him.

"Let him hit me." Tang Ling stood up with a smile on his face and spat a mouthful of bloody saliva.

"Deere, stop." At the same time, Andrew also spoke up.

If it was possible, Andrew really wanted to kill Tang Ling right there and then, but not now.

Dier's punch was considered to have regained the dignity of the Summit Squad, but if it continued, it would be too much.

"I admire your courage. You still have a long time in the First Reserved Camp, so I hope you can maintain your courage.

Bravery is a virtue after all. "
